Output 6882d3286bde81a7bbbc596a433958629c23e5aa6fa482cef494ecf39e32c576:18

value
72689071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e7b3e0d49f4ce3c2ba81ab0a951cf4eb4f5aec2 OP_EQUAL
address
MNM8dmfC8KNhZqr2Fma8D9p434eMwdbDep
transaction
6882d3286bde81a7bbbc596a433958629c23e5aa6fa482cef494ecf39e32c576
spent
true